我有一个UILabel我想在顶部和底部添加空间的地方.在约束中使用最小高度我将其修改为:

编辑:要做到这一点,我用过:
override func drawTextInRect(rect: CGRect) {
var insets: UIEdgeInsets = UIEdgeInsets(top: 0.0, left: 10.0, bottom: 0.0, right: 10.0)
super.drawTextInRect(UIEdgeInsetsInsetRect(rect, insets))
}
Run Code Online (Sandbox Code Playgroud)
但我要找到一种不同的方法,因为如果我写两行以上的问题是相同的:

我很困惑,因为我习惯于通过这样的函数来获取var:
class ViewController: UIViewController {
var timerVal:Int = calcolo()
func calcolo() -> Int {
return 0;
}
}
Run Code Online (Sandbox Code Playgroud)
但它不起作用.问题是:在调用中缺少参数#1的参数.